Ryker Phillips, the Moonstone pack enforcer, is sent under cover to the Idaho pack in order to find mistreatment and corrupt plans. He meets Ivy Campbell, a girl who has been mistreated by her pack her entire life. Her desire to run away but constant eyes prevent her from exceeding. Ivy fights the mate bond with Ryker out of trauma but is determined to help her pack out of her current leader and his overwhelming need for control. Both fights to save the pack and keep the current safety with all the packs.

“Ryker by Margo Bond Collins was okay, but I had I a few dislikes with it. One of those was Ryker needed to infiltrate the pack by fitting in, which means he needed to pretend to be as cruel as the rest but he kept showing a merciful and compassionate side to the pack leader which made him a very bad spy. Another was that the fighting and ending was anticlimactic and repetitive. It was still entertaining and an easy read and worth the time invested in the mated bond between Ivy and Ryker. 3 out of 5 stars.

Title: Ryker
Author: Margo Bond Collins
Genre: Paranormal Romance
Rating: 3.5 stars

Review: I enjoyed this book, although I have to admit that I wanted more at the end. I liked the two MCs, and as this is a Fated Mates shifter story, you can expect the feelings between them to move fast, but it was a little more believable here. THe FMC didn’t just throw herself at him and expect him to solve her problems. She had a past that dictated that males weren’t to be trusted, and she is hesitant. I appreciated that, because I have read others where the FMC is traumatized and yet has no thoughts for what she’s been through previously once the hero arrived. It was nice to see this wasn’t the case here.

I wanted there to be more depth. The ending battle seemed a little anticlimactic for me, and I wanted more explanation of a few of the characters' motivations for some of their choices. In the book’s defense, it is part of a series, and I have only read this one, so perhaps I am missing some info in other books.

Overall, if you are a shifter romance fan, and like the Fated Mates trope, you will enjoy this book. Definitely give it a try. Be sure, however, to pay attention to the trigger warnings.

Rated 2.5 Stars

I liked the sound of Ryker but it didn't work for me at all. It was repetitious and the characters words did not match their actions. There was no connection between the hero and heroine. It was stated that there was a connection between them but there was no actual building of a relationship between them. I can't define their relationship as instalove because it wasn't that either. I get that this was a short book and there's only so much that can be done within the number of pages but I had hoped for more. There was a lot of potential that was never realized. There was just too much telling and not showing which ultimately made this a dud for me.

Ryker is the wolf enforcer for the Moonstone Pack. He is sent undercover to see what the Idaho Pack is up to. While infiltrating the pack, he meets Ivy. Ivy is beautiful and a healer but her alpha is evil and uses the women. Ivy has trust issues and she doesn't trust Ryker but something about him pulls at her. When Ryker's cover is blown, will Ivy back him up or turn him in?

Action. A little sex. Werewolves. Two feuding packs. Ryker will do anything to protect his pack and his mate. Ivy realizes she's stronger than she ever thought.
